United States: A Stable Investment Paradise
The US real estate market has long been a popular choice for overseas investors, especially among Chinese investors, where the US has always held a significant position. The US real estate market boasts a relatively stable investment environment, especially in major cities like New York, Los Angeles, San Francisco, and Miami, which have consistently been key areas of focus for investors.
The advantages of the US real estate market are primarily reflected in its transparent legal system and stable economic environment. The US has a clear land ownership system with strict legal protections and high market liquidity, making real estate transactions relatively safe for investors. Furthermore, the US rental market is highly mature, with many investors choosing to purchase properties for rental income to obtain long-term, stable cash flow returns. Simultaneously, the diversified market in the US is also a significant factor attracting investors. Different regions offer different investment opportunities; for example, New York’s commercial real estate market, California’s high-end residential market, and Florida’s vacation properties have all attracted substantial investment. In short, the US real estate market, with its stability, transparency, and diversified options, has become a favorite among global investors.
UK: Tight Market Demand
In recent years, although the UK real estate market has been affected by some economic uncertainties and political factors, it remains a hot spot for global investors. London, in particular, as a global financial center, maintains a strong appeal for its real estate market.
London’s real estate market has consistently enjoyed high demand, especially for luxury homes and high-end apartments in central areas. Despite the uncertainty caused by Brexit in recent years, London’s status as a global financial and cultural center remains unchanged. Furthermore, the volatility of the pound sterling has provided more favorable entry opportunities for foreign investors, thus maintaining the high investment attractiveness of London’s real estate market. In addition, the real estate markets of other UK cities such as Manchester and Birmingham are gradually emerging. With the gradual recovery of the UK economy, especially in some non-core areas where prices are relatively reasonable, they are attracting increasing attention from overseas investors.
Australia: A High-Quality Lifestyle
As a popular investment destination in the Asia-Pacific region, Australia has consistently attracted the attention of numerous foreign investors. Sydney and Melbourne are the most popular cities, with Sydney, as one of the world’s most livable cities, attracting many investors seeking a high-quality lifestyle.
The appeal of Australia’s real estate market lies in its robust economic development and high quality of life. Many people choose to buy property in Australia because of its excellent resources in education, healthcare, and environment. Especially for young families, Australia offers a better living environment and living conditions. At the same time, the Australian government’s relatively relaxed policies towards foreign investors have attracted a large influx of capital into the country’s real estate market. Sydney and Melbourne’s real estate markets have consistently maintained high levels, and even amidst global economic fluctuations, the overall performance of the Australian real estate market remains strong.
Singapore: Efficient Market Operations
Singapore is one of the most developed economies in Southeast Asia, and its real estate market has always been favored by international investors. As Asia’s financial center, Singapore boasts high market transparency and a well-developed legal system. Investors can invest in real estate in a relatively stable environment.
The attractiveness of Singapore’s real estate market lies primarily in several aspects: Firstly, its economic stability and policy transparency, especially the government’s strict regulation of the real estate market, ensures a relatively healthy market and avoids excessive speculation. Secondly, Singapore’s central location in Asia, with its highly developed logistics, commerce, and finance sectors, enhances the value of its real estate market. Singapore’s high-end residential and commercial real estate markets, especially luxury homes and office buildings in the city center, have long attracted a large number of overseas investors. Due to Singapore’s unique geographical and economic advantages, its real estate market is expected to continue its strong performance.
